Home
last modified time | relevance | path

Searched refs:pkt_list (Results 1 – 25 of 26) sorted by relevance

12

/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852bs/core/
H A Drtw_xmit_shortcut.c103 struct rtw_pkt_buf_list *pkt_list = NULL; in _print_txreq_pklist() local
119 p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in _print_txreq_pklist()
127 txsc_dump_data(pkt_list->vir_addr, pkt_list->length, "pkt_list"); in _print_txreq_pklist()
128 pkt_list++; in _print_txreq_pklist()
247 struct rtw_pkt_buf_list *p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in txsc_recycle_txreq_phyaddr() local
251 pkt_list++; in txsc_recycle_txreq_phyaddr()
253 phy_addr = (pkt_list->phy_addr_l); in txsc_recycle_txreq_phyaddr()
255 phy_addr |= ((u64)pkt_list->phy_addr_h << 32); in txsc_recycle_txreq_phyaddr()
257 pci_unmap_bus_addr(pdev, &phy_addr, pkt_list->length, PCI_DMA_TODEVICE); in txsc_recycle_txreq_phyaddr()
260 void txsc_fill_txreq_phyaddr(_adapter *padapter, struct rtw_pkt_buf_list *pkt_list) in txsc_fill_txreq_phyaddr() argument
[all …]
H A Drtw_xmit.c101 ptxreq_buf->pkt_list = padapter->tx_pool_ring[idx] + offset_list; in alloc_txring()
169 u8 *txreq = NULL, *pkt_list = NULL; in _rtw_init_xmit_priv() local
335 pkt_list = pxmitpriv->xframe_ext_txreq + sizeof(struct rtw_xmit_req); in _rtw_init_xmit_priv()
357 pxframe->phl_txreq->pkt_list = pkt_list; in _rtw_init_xmit_priv()
364 pkt_list += SZ_MGT_RING; in _rtw_init_xmit_priv()
5083 struct rtw_pkt_buf_list *pkt_list = NULL; in core_tx_free_xmitframe() local
5115 p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in core_tx_free_xmitframe()
5116 if (pkt_list->vir_addr && pkt_list->length) in core_tx_free_xmitframe()
5117 rtw_mfree(pkt_list->vir_addr, pkt_list->length); in core_tx_free_xmitframe()
6371 u8 *get_txreq_buffer(_adapter *padapter, u8 **txreq, u8 **pkt_list, u8 **head, u8 **tail) in get_txreq_buffer() argument
[all …]
H A Drtw_security.c283 struct rtw_pkt_buf_list *pkt_list = NULL; in rtw_wep_encrypt() local
305 p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in rtw_wep_encrypt()
306 pframe = pkt_list->vir_addr; in rtw_wep_encrypt()
307 length = pkt_list->length - pattrib->hdrlen in rtw_wep_encrypt()
710 struct rtw_pkt_buf_list *pkt_list = NULL; in rtw_tkip_encrypt() local
736 p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in rtw_tkip_encrypt()
737 pframe = pkt_list->vir_addr; in rtw_tkip_encrypt()
738 length = pkt_list->length - pattrib->hdrlen in rtw_tkip_encrypt()
1578 struct rtw_pkt_buf_list *pkt_list = NULL; in rtw_aes_encrypt() local
1611 p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in rtw_aes_encrypt()
[all …]
H A Drtw_cmd.c4765 struct rtw_pkt_buf_list *pkt_list =(struct rtw_pkt_buf_list *)txreq->pkt_list;
4773 record->totalSz += pkt_list->length;
4774 record->fragLen[idx1] = pkt_list->length;
4775 record->virtAddr[idx1] = pkt_list->vir_addr;
4776 record->phyAddrL[idx1] = pkt_list->phy_addr_l;
4777 record->phyAddrH[idx1] = pkt_list->phy_addr_h;
4778 pkt_list++;
4793 struct rtw_pkt_buf_list *pkt = rx_req->pkt_list;
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852be/core/
H A Drtw_xmit_shortcut.c103 struct rtw_pkt_buf_list *pkt_list = NULL; in _print_txreq_pklist() local
119 p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in _print_txreq_pklist()
127 txsc_dump_data(pkt_list->vir_addr, pkt_list->length, "pkt_list"); in _print_txreq_pklist()
128 pkt_list++; in _print_txreq_pklist()
247 struct rtw_pkt_buf_list *p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in txsc_recycle_txreq_phyaddr() local
251 pkt_list++; in txsc_recycle_txreq_phyaddr()
253 phy_addr = (pkt_list->phy_addr_l); in txsc_recycle_txreq_phyaddr()
255 phy_addr |= ((u64)pkt_list->phy_addr_h << 32); in txsc_recycle_txreq_phyaddr()
257 pci_unmap_bus_addr(pdev, &phy_addr, pkt_list->length, PCI_DMA_TODEVICE); in txsc_recycle_txreq_phyaddr()
260 void txsc_fill_txreq_phyaddr(_adapter *padapter, struct rtw_pkt_buf_list *pkt_list) in txsc_fill_txreq_phyaddr() argument
[all …]
H A Drtw_xmit.c102 ptxreq_buf->pkt_list = padapter->tx_pool_ring[idx] + offset_list; in alloc_txring()
173 u8 *txreq = NULL, *pkt_list = NULL; in _rtw_init_xmit_priv() local
339 pkt_list = pxmitpriv->xframe_ext_txreq + sizeof(struct rtw_xmit_req); in _rtw_init_xmit_priv()
361 pxframe->phl_txreq->pkt_list = pkt_list; in _rtw_init_xmit_priv()
369 pkt_list += SZ_MGT_RING; in _rtw_init_xmit_priv()
5090 struct rtw_pkt_buf_list *pkt_list = NULL; in core_tx_free_xmitframe() local
5122 p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in core_tx_free_xmitframe()
5123 if (pkt_list->vir_addr && pkt_list->length) in core_tx_free_xmitframe()
5124 rtw_mfree(pkt_list->vir_addr, pkt_list->length); in core_tx_free_xmitframe()
6378 u8 *get_txreq_buffer(_adapter *padapter, u8 **txreq, u8 **pkt_list, u8 **head, u8 **tail) in get_txreq_buffer() argument
[all …]
H A Drtw_security.c283 struct rtw_pkt_buf_list *pkt_list = NULL; in rtw_wep_encrypt() local
305 p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in rtw_wep_encrypt()
306 pframe = pkt_list->vir_addr; in rtw_wep_encrypt()
307 length = pkt_list->length - pattrib->hdrlen in rtw_wep_encrypt()
710 struct rtw_pkt_buf_list *pkt_list = NULL; in rtw_tkip_encrypt() local
736 p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in rtw_tkip_encrypt()
737 pframe = pkt_list->vir_addr; in rtw_tkip_encrypt()
738 length = pkt_list->length - pattrib->hdrlen in rtw_tkip_encrypt()
1578 struct rtw_pkt_buf_list *pkt_list = NULL; in rtw_aes_encrypt() local
1611 pkt_list = (struct rtw_pkt_buf_list *)txreq->pkt_list; in rtw_aes_encrypt()
[all …]
H A Drtw_cmd.c4743 struct rtw_pkt_buf_list *pkt_list =(struct rtw_pkt_buf_list *)txreq->pkt_list;
4751 record->totalSz += pkt_list->length;
4752 record->fragLen[idx1] = pkt_list->length;
4753 record->virtAddr[idx1] = pkt_list->vir_addr;
4754 record->phyAddrL[idx1] = pkt_list->phy_addr_l;
4755 record->phyAddrH[idx1] = pkt_list->phy_addr_h;
4756 pkt_list++;
4771 struct rtw_pkt_buf_list *pkt = rx_req->pkt_list;
H A Drtw_recv.c4838 struct rtw_pkt_buf_list *pkt = rx_req->pkt_list; in core_update_recvframe_pkt()
4864 pktbuf = phlrx->pkt_list; /* &phlrx->pkt_list[0] */ in core_alloc_recvframe_pkt()
/OK3568_Linux_fs/kernel/net/vmw_vsock/
H A Dvsock_loopback.c19 struct list_head pkt_list; member
36 list_add_tail(&pkt->list, &vsock->pkt_list); in vsock_loopback_send_pkt()
51 list_for_each_entry_safe(pkt, n, &vsock->pkt_list, list) { in vsock_loopback_cancel_pkt()
115 list_splice_init(&vsock->pkt_list, &pkts); in vsock_loopback_work()
139 INIT_LIST_HEAD(&vsock->pkt_list); in vsock_loopback_init()
164 while (!list_empty(&vsock->pkt_list)) { in vsock_loopback_exit()
165 pkt = list_first_entry(&vsock->pkt_list, in vsock_loopback_exit()
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852be/phl/test/
H A Dtrx_test.c146 _os_mem_set(drv_priv, &rreq->rx.pkt_list, 0, in _phl_release_rx_req()
147 sizeof(rreq->rx.pkt_list) * rreq->rx.pkt_cnt); in _phl_release_rx_req()
315 treq->pkt_list = NULL; in _phl_release_tx_req()
814 debug_dump_data(recvpkt->pkt_list[0].vir_addr, in rtw_phl_test_rx_callback()
815 recvpkt->pkt_list[0].length, "Rx Pkt: "); in rtw_phl_test_rx_callback()
858 pkt = (struct rtw_pkt_buf_list *)treq->pkt_list; in rtw_phl_rx_reap()
867 recvpkt->pkt_list[i].vir_addr = pkt->vir_addr; in rtw_phl_rx_reap()
868 recvpkt->pkt_list[i].phy_addr_l = pkt->phy_addr_l; in rtw_phl_rx_reap()
869 recvpkt->pkt_list[i].phy_addr_h = pkt->phy_addr_h; in rtw_phl_rx_reap()
870 recvpkt->pkt_list[i].length = pkt->length; in rtw_phl_rx_reap()
[all …]
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852bs/phl/test/
H A Dtrx_test.c146 _os_mem_set(drv_priv, &rreq->rx.pkt_list, 0, in _phl_release_rx_req()
147 sizeof(rreq->rx.pkt_list) * rreq->rx.pkt_cnt); in _phl_release_rx_req()
315 treq->pkt_list = NULL; in _phl_release_tx_req()
814 debug_dump_data(recvpkt->pkt_list[0].vir_addr, in rtw_phl_test_rx_callback()
815 recvpkt->pkt_list[0].length, "Rx Pkt: "); in rtw_phl_test_rx_callback()
858 pkt = (struct rtw_pkt_buf_list *)treq->pkt_list; in rtw_phl_rx_reap()
867 recvpkt->pkt_list[i].vir_addr = pkt->vir_addr; in rtw_phl_rx_reap()
868 recvpkt->pkt_list[i].phy_addr_l = pkt->phy_addr_l; in rtw_phl_rx_reap()
869 recvpkt->pkt_list[i].phy_addr_h = pkt->phy_addr_h; in rtw_phl_rx_reap()
870 recvpkt->pkt_list[i].length = pkt->length; in rtw_phl_rx_reap()
[all …]
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852bs/phl/hci/
H A Dphl_trx_sdio.c327 pkt_buf = (struct rtw_pkt_buf_list *)tx_req->pkt_list; in _phl_prepare_tx_sdio()
902 phl_rx->r.pkt_list->vir_addr = rxbuf->pkt[i].pkt; in phl_rx_sdio()
903 phl_rx->r.pkt_list->length = rxbuf->pkt[i].pkt_len; in phl_rx_sdio()
931 mfrag = PHL_GET_80211_HDR_MORE_FRAG(phl_rx->r.pkt_list[0].vir_addr); in phl_rx_sdio()
932 frag_num = PHL_GET_80211_HDR_FRAG_NUM(phl_rx->r.pkt_list[0].vir_addr); in phl_rx_sdio()
935 if (phl_rx->r.pkt_list[0].length < RTW_MAX_ETH_PKT_LEN) in phl_rx_sdio()
938 netbuf_len = phl_rx->r.pkt_list[0].length; in phl_rx_sdio()
940 netbuf_len = phl_rx->r.pkt_list[0].length; in phl_rx_sdio()
949 phl_rx->r.pkt_list[0].vir_addr, phl_rx->r.pkt_list[0].length); in phl_rx_sdio()
950 phl_rx->r.pkt_list[0].vir_addr = netbuf; in phl_rx_sdio()
[all …]
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852be/phl/
H A Dphl_trx_def.h431 u8 *pkt_list; member
459 struct rtw_pkt_buf_list pkt_list[MAX_RX_BUF_SEG_NUM]; member
H A Dphl_rx.c869 if (phl_rx->r.pkt_list[0].length <= 4) { in phl_rx_reorder()
871 __func__, phl_rx->r.pkt_list[0].length); in phl_rx_reorder()
874 phl_rx->r.pkt_list[0].length -= 4; in phl_rx_reorder()
1264 _os_list *pkt_list = NULL; in _phl_rx_proc_frame_list() local
1276 while (true == pq_pop(d, pq, &pkt_list, _first, _bh)) { in _phl_rx_proc_frame_list()
1277 phl_rx = (struct rtw_phl_rx_pkt *)pkt_list; in _phl_rx_proc_frame_list()
1355 PHL_GET_80211_HDR_TYPE(phl_rx->r.pkt_list[0].vir_addr); in phl_rx_proc_phy_sts()
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852bs/phl/
H A Dphl_trx_def.h434 u8 *pkt_list; member
461 struct rtw_pkt_buf_list pkt_list[MAX_RX_BUF_SEG_NUM]; member
H A Dphl_rx.c864 if (phl_rx->r.pkt_list[0].length <= 4) { in phl_rx_reorder()
866 __func__, phl_rx->r.pkt_list[0].length); in phl_rx_reorder()
869 phl_rx->r.pkt_list[0].length -= 4; in phl_rx_reorder()
1259 _os_list *pkt_list = NULL; in _phl_rx_proc_frame_list() local
1271 while (true == pq_pop(d, pq, &pkt_list, _first, _bh)) { in _phl_rx_proc_frame_list()
1272 phl_rx = (struct rtw_phl_rx_pkt *)pkt_list; in _phl_rx_proc_frame_list()
1350 PHL_GET_80211_HDR_TYPE(phl_rx->r.pkt_list[0].vir_addr); in phl_rx_proc_phy_sts()
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852be/include/
H A Drtw_xmit_shortcut.h87 void txsc_fill_txreq_phyaddr(_adapter *padapter, struct rtw_pkt_buf_list *pkt_list);
H A Drtw_xmit.h708 u8 *pkt_list; member
1096 u8 *get_txreq_buffer(_adapter *padapter, u8 **txreq, u8 **pkt_list, u8 **head, u8 **tail);
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852bs/include/
H A Drtw_xmit_shortcut.h87 void txsc_fill_txreq_phyaddr(_adapter *padapter, struct rtw_pkt_buf_list *pkt_list);
H A Drtw_xmit.h704 u8 *pkt_list; member
1092 u8 *get_txreq_buffer(_adapter *padapter, u8 **txreq, u8 **pkt_list, u8 **head, u8 **tail);
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852be/phl/hal_g6/rtl8852b/pci/
H A Dhal_trx_8852be.c625 struct rtw_pkt_buf_list *pkt_list = NULL; in hal_update_wd_8852be() local
635 pkt_list = (struct rtw_pkt_buf_list *)tx_req->pkt_list; in hal_update_wd_8852be()
665 &pkt_list[i], wp_num, mpdu_ls, msdu_ls); in hal_update_wd_8852be()
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852bs/phl/hal_g6/rtl8852b/
H A Dhal_trx_8852b.c464 struct rtw_pkt_buf_list *pkt = &r->pkt_list[0]; in hal_handle_rx_buffer_8852b()
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852be/phl/hal_g6/rtl8852b/
H A Dhal_trx_8852b.c464 struct rtw_pkt_buf_list *pkt = &r->pkt_list[0]; in hal_handle_rx_buffer_8852b()
/OK3568_Linux_fs/external/rkwifibt/drivers/rtl8852be/phl/hci/
H A Dphl_trx_pcie.c2667 pkt_buf = (struct rtw_pkt_buf_list *)&tx_req->pkt_list[0]; in phl_prepare_tx_pcie()
3297 struct rtw_pkt_buf_list *pkt_buf = (struct rtw_pkt_buf_list *)treq->pkt_list; in _phl_wp_rpt_chk_txsts()
3468 pkt = r->pkt_list[0].vir_addr; in _phl_rx_handle_wp_report()
3469 pkt_len = r->pkt_list[0].length; in _phl_rx_handle_wp_report()

12